This page shows the technical details of what happened when the authorised researcher Brian Mackenna (Gmail) requested one or more actions to be run against real patient data within a secure environment.

By cross-referencing the list of jobs with the pipeline section below, you can infer what security level the outputs were written to.

The output security levels are:

  • highly_sensitive
    • Researchers can never directly view these outputs
    • Researchers can only request code is run against them
  • moderately_sensitive
    • Can be viewed by an approved researcher by logging into a highly secure environment
    • These are the only outputs that can be requested for public release via a controlled output review service.
